Hello, I have an issue with item 27. So I'm basically in OPS 104 with STS-1 mission after orbit insertion, I input all the data in the computer, execute the burn and everything works perfectly. Then I switch to OPS 105 to prepare for the OMS-2 burn, however I have noticed that item 27 remains checked from OPS 104. I input all the data as before and execute but the TTG timer does not start and the shuttle doesn't maneuver to the correct attitude and the flashing EXEC does not light up, anybody know how to fix this problem?

There's seems to be a problem with ITEM 27 if you do an OMS-1 burn and then mode over to MM105. You can't deselect it and it seems to default to a retrograde burn attitude even if the X-axis DV (ITEM 19) is set to a positive value. I have checked this twice now and have replicated it both times.

So there seems to some sort of transition issue between MM104/MM105. Considering we're getting rid of the current DPS implementation for the next version, I won't file an actual ticket on this.

I've got a little update on this one:

The issue with Item 27 is not limited to ops switch, if you load burn data with item 22, do item 27 and than change the data, reload them and do item 27 again, the computer won't maneuver into the new orientation - it's as if item 27 could only be executed once.

Got tired of hw tonight and so I returned to sw (and SSU :)) for one night, and took a quick look at this. The burn data/variables are all preserved on MM transitions that use the MNVR display (and sw), which isn't allowing new data to be used. I added a reset on MM105 PRO to clean any previous burn data (like it is done on MM transitions "out of MNVR"), and it seems to work now.
